打造高效的虚拟主机管理系统 (一套虚拟主机管理系统)
随着互联网的迅速发展,虚拟主机已成为许多企业和个人网站的不二之选。虚拟主机提供了安全、可靠、高效、便捷的网络空间,满足了人们不同需求的各种互联网应用。同时,虚拟主机也需要一个高效的管理系统来保证其正常运行,避免数据丢失和服务中断等问题。本文将探讨如何,以提供更好的服务质量和用户体验。
一、虚拟主机管理系统的基本架构
虚拟主机管理系统的基本架构包括硬件设备、操作系统、虚拟化软件、管理软件等多个方面。其中,硬件设备包括服务器、磁盘、网络设备等;操作系统是支撑虚拟化技术的基础,Linux和Windows等操作系统广泛应用于虚拟主机管理系统中;虚拟化软件是虚拟主机管理系统的核心,虚拟化技术分为三种类型:全虚拟化、半虚拟化和容器化;管理软件包括Web应用程序、后台管理工具等多个方面,主要用于对虚拟主机进行监控、调度、故障排除等。
二、虚拟主机管理系统的功能模块
虚拟主机管理系统的功能模块包括虚拟主机的创建、配置、管理、监控等多个方面。具体来说,虚拟主机管理系统应具备以下几个基本功能模块:
1.虚拟机创建模块:该模块主要用于创建虚拟机,包括选择虚拟机的操作系统、CPU、内存、磁盘容量等参数,创建完成后,系统自动安装操作系统和应用程序。
2.虚拟机配置模块:该模块主要用于配置虚拟机,包括添加、删除、修改虚拟机的CPU、内存、磁盘容量等参数,对虚拟机进行维护和管理。
3.虚拟机监控模块:该模块主要用于监控虚拟机的性能和状态,包括CPU使用率、内存使用率、磁盘使用率等指标,及时发现虚拟机运行异常情况,避免数据丢失和服务中断等问题。
4.虚拟机迁移模块:该模块主要用于将虚拟机从一台物理服务器迁移到另一台物理服务器,以实现虚拟机的高可用性和负载均衡。
5.虚拟机备份和恢复模块:该模块主要用于备份和恢复虚拟机数据,以保证虚拟机数据的安全性和完整性,避免因数据丢失造成的损失。
6.虚拟机资源池管理模块:该模块用于对虚拟机资源进行管理和调度,包括虚拟机的启动、停止、重启、暂停等功能,实现对虚拟机的全面控制和管理。
三、虚拟主机管理系统的优化点
在的过程中,需要注意以下几个优化点:
1. 高可用性:为了保证虚拟主机系统的高可用性,需要使用多台物理服务器进行负载均衡和冗余备份。在一台物理服务器出现故障时,其他服务器可以自动接替它的功能,从而保持服务的连续性和稳定性。
2.性能优化:虚拟主机管理系统必须具备高性能和低延迟的特点。为了达到这一目标,需要对系统进行优化和调整,包括操作系统的优化、虚拟化软件的优化、虚拟机的性能调整等。
3.安全可靠:虚拟主机管理系统必须具备高安全性和可靠性。为此,需要对系统进行安全加固、权限管理等方面的处理,保证虚拟机的安全性和隐私性。
4.易用性:虚拟主机管理系统必须易于操作,界面友好,功能齐全,用户体验良好。只有这样才能吸引更多的用户使用,并提高用户满意度和忠诚度。
四、虚拟主机管理系统的市场应用
虚拟主机管理系统已经成为互联网领域中应用非常广泛的技术之一。根据不同使用场景和需求,虚拟主机管理系统在市场中有不同的应用方向,如下图所示:
1.企业级虚拟主机管理系统:主要面向中小企业,具有价格低廉、易用性强、扩展性好等特点。
2.云计算虚拟主机管理系统:主要面向互联网企业和大型机构,具有高度可扩展、高可靠性和高性能等特点。
3.教育和科研虚拟主机管理系统:主要用于教育和科研领域,支持课程实验、科研模拟等应用场景,具有模块化、易扩展等特点。
结论
随着虚拟化技术的不断发展和完善,虚拟主机管理系统已经成为许多企业和个人的首选。在的过程中,需要注重系统的稳定性、性能优化、安全可靠以及易用性。只有通过不断的优化和升级,才能满足不同用户的需求,并提供更好的服务质量和用户体验。